Step 3
Explain why ethanol is very soluble in water.

Answer
Ethanol is very soluble in water due to its polar nature. The presence of the hydroxyl (-OH) group allows ethanol to form hydrogen bonds with water molecules. This interaction is crucial because 'like dissolves like', meaning that polar solvents such as water can effectively dissolve other polar substances like ethanol.
